Heptapeptide-38 Dimer

INCI: Heptapeptide-38 Dimer

A synthetic peptide that may help improve skin firmness and smooth fine lines, but research is still emerging.

beautyskincareanti-aging

In plain English

Heptapeptide-38 Dimer is a lab-made peptide (a short chain of amino acids) that is designed to signal skin cells to produce more collagen and elastin, which are proteins that keep skin firm and plump. Think of it as a tiny messenger that tells your skin to act younger. It's often used in anti-aging products, but because it's relatively new, the research backing its effectiveness is still growing.

What it is

Heptapeptide-38 Dimer is a synthetic peptide composed of seven amino acids (heptapeptide) that has been dimerized (linked to another identical peptide) to potentially enhance its stability and activity. It is designed to mimic natural peptide signals in the skin that regulate collagen production.

How it works

In a cosmetic product, Heptapeptide-38 Dimer is believed to penetrate the upper layers of the skin and bind to receptors on fibroblasts (the cells that produce collagen). This binding triggers a signaling cascade that encourages fibroblasts to increase collagen and elastin synthesis. The dimer structure may improve the peptide's resistance to breakdown by skin enzymes, allowing it to work longer.

Pros

Gentle on skin

Heptapeptide-38 Dimer has a low irritation risk, making it suitable for sensitive skin types that may react to stronger anti-aging ingredients like retinoids or acids.

Targets collagen production

Unlike surface-level moisturizers, this peptide works by signaling skin cells to produce more collagen, which can lead to firmer, more resilient skin over time.

Cons and cautions

Emerging evidence

While promising, the research on Heptapeptide-38 Dimer is still limited compared to well-studied peptides like Matrixyl. Results may vary and are not guaranteed.

Higher cost

Products containing this peptide tend to be more expensive due to the complexity of synthesizing and stabilizing the dimer structure, which may not fit every budget.

Usage tips

Apply products with Heptapeptide-38 Dimer to clean, damp skin to enhance absorption.
Use consistently for at least 8-12 weeks to see visible improvements in skin firmness.
Layer with a moisturizer containing ceramides or hyaluronic acid to support the skin barrier.

Safety summary

Heptapeptide-38 Dimer is considered safe for topical use in cosmetics at typical concentrations. It has a low risk of irritation or allergic reaction. However, as with any new ingredient, patch testing is recommended for those with very sensitive skin.

Research notes

Research on Heptapeptide-38 Dimer is still emerging. Early in vitro studies suggest it can stimulate collagen production, but robust human clinical trials are limited. It is part of a newer generation of peptides designed for improved stability and efficacy.

Common label clues

Typical concentration
Typically used at 0.5% to 2% in leave-on products
Regulatory status
Approved for use in cosmetics in the US, EU, and other major markets. It is not classified as a drug and cannot claim to treat or cure skin conditions.
Common uses
Anti-aging serums, Eye creams, Facial moisturizers
Environmental note
As a synthetic peptide, it is produced in a lab and does not involve animal-derived ingredients. Its environmental impact is tied to the manufacturing process, which is generally low compared to natural extracts that require harvesting.

Good to know

  • Peptides are often listed near the middle or end of an ingredient list because they are effective at low concentrations.
  • Heptapeptide-38 Dimer is sometimes combined with other peptides in a single product for a multi-targeted anti-aging approach.
